Warning Signs You Need Behind Wall Water Extraction in Greenwood, MO
Ignoring the signs of water damage behind your walls can lead to costly repairs and health risks. Here are some warning signs you shouldn’t ignore:
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away
Unpleasant Smells: If you notice persistent musty odors in your home, it may be a sign of water damage behind your walls.
Warped or Buckled Drywall
Visible Damage: Check for signs of water damage on your walls, such as warping or buckling drywall.
Water Stains on Ceiling or Walls
Visible Stains: Look for water stains on your ceiling or walls, which can show a leak or water damage behind the walls.
Increased Humidity or Mold Growth
Mold Growth: If you notice increased humidity or mold growth in your home, it may be a sign of water damage behind your walls.
Unexplained Leaks or Water Spots
Unexplained Leaks: If you notice unexplained leaks or water spots on your walls or ceiling, it’s essential to investigate further.
Electrical Issues or Flickering Lights
Electrical Issues: If you experience electrical issues or flickering lights, it may be a sign of water damage behind your walls.

Behind Wall Water Extraction Cost in Greenwood, MO
The cost of behind wall water extraction can vary depending on the severity, size of the affected area, and local conditions in Greenwood, MO. Here’s a rough estimate of what you might expect:
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Water Extraction | $500 – $2,500 | Size of affected area, severity of damage, and equipment needed |
| Drying and Dehumidification | $1,000 – $5,000 | Size of affected area, number of dehumidifiers needed, and drying time |
| Cleaning and Sanitizing | $1,500 – $6,000 | Size of affected area, type of cleaning solutions needed, and labor required |
| Restoration and Reconstruction | $2,000 – $10,000 | Size of affected area, type of materials needed, and labor required |
| Emergency Response | $100 – $500 | Time of day, distance from our location, and equipment needed |
Keep in mind that these estimates are rough and may vary depending on the specifics of your situation. We offer free on-site assessments to provide a more accurate estimate of the costs involved.

Common Questions About Behind Wall Water Extraction
Q: Will I need to replace my drywall?
Maybe: It depends on the extent of the damage. If the drywall is severely damaged, it may need to be replaced. But, if the damage is minor, we can often repair it without replacing the entire wall.
Q: How long will it take to dry out my property?
3-5 days: The drying process can take anywhere from 3-5 days, depending on the size of the affected area and the severity of the damage.
Q: Will I need to pay for a mold remediation service?
Maybe: If we find mold growth during the extraction process, we may recommend a mold remediation service to ensure the area is safe and healthy.
Q: Can I handle the water extraction myself?
No: Water extraction needs specialized equipment and expertise to prevent further damage and ensure a thorough drying process. It’s best to leave it to the professionals.
Q: Will I need to file an insurance claim?
Maybe: If the water damage is caused by a covered event (e.g., burst pipe or appliance failure), you may need to file an insurance claim to cover the costs of the repair.
